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 187039-59-4 includes 9 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 6 digits, 1,8,7,0,3 and 9 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 5 and 9 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 187039-59:
(8*1)+(7*8)+(6*7)+(5*0)+(4*3)+(3*9)+(2*5)+(1*9)=164
164 % 10 = 4
So 187039-59-4 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

First synthesis of 2,6-diazabicyclo[3.2.0]heptane derivatives

Napolitano, Carmela,Borriello, Manuela,Cardullo, Francesca,Donati, Daniele,Paio, Alfredo,Manfredini, Stefano

scheme or table, p. 7280 - 7282 (2010/03/03)

The first synthesis of 6-phenyl-2,6-diazabicyclo[3.2.0]heptane 1 and its orthogonally protected precursor 2 is herein reported. Our strategy enables to chemically address the two nitrogen atoms of 2,6-diazabicyclo[3.2.0]heptane core individually and selectively, thus allowing rapid access to several subsets of widely substituted fused azetidines.

A short synthesis of an important precursor to a new class of bicyclic β-lactamase inhibitors

Bellettini, John R.,Miller, Marvin J.

, p. 167 - 168 (2007/10/03)

A short synthesis of an important precursor to known bicyclic β-lactamase inhibitors is described. The synthesis uses commercially available trans-3-hydroxy-L-proline 1. Protection of the amino group followed by formation of the hydroxamate and cyclization using Mitsunobu conditions afforded bicyclic β-lactam 4 in three steps in 53% overall yield.
